It's possible that the connection at CN2, the pins on the ecm, doesn't make contact with the supplied connector/cable (S200 users). Same goes for the Hondata blue box side as well...
Open up your ecm (car ecu), turn the car key to the on position just enough to prime the fuel pump, look at your Hondata control box the little red led should now be on, if so wiggle the wiring at one end first CN2/Hondata Box, does the led go out? If so you have an intermittent bad connection at either end...
